Hint 1, worth 5 points

For something that flies, my tongue is so long it loops right around inside my own skull.

Hint 2, worth 4 points

Two of my toes point forward and two point back, so I can climb straight up a tree.

Hint 3, worth 3 points

Stiff tail feathers prop me up as I chip at bark, digging out bugs most beaks can't reach.

Hint 4, worth 2 points

My fast hammering on a hollow tree is my song, and a cartoon gave me a wild laugh.

Hint 5, worth 1 point

Hear my rat-a-tat high in the trees: a small red-capped bird hard at work on a dead pine.

Reveal the answer to Rung #50
WOODPECKER
A woodpecker can strike its beak against a tree around 20 times a second, fast enough to blur, and drums thousands of times a day.
